Operation Big Girl - Phase Two

I have decided that it is time for Elise to start to potty train. A few months ago she was displaying all of the readiness signs. Dry diapers, she would let you know when she went to the bathroom, all of it. I didn't potty train her because I was too pregnant and I had heard so much about regressing and not taking on new things before siblings were born that I didn't capitalize on it.

Well, now she shows no interest, and I was waiting until she began to again. But yesterday I read a book that I took out from the library entitled Diaper Free before 3, it says that there is no need to wait for readiness signs. That before disposable diapers children used to potty train much earlier. So, I thought here goes nothing potty training is beginning.

Today I told her when she woke up that while we are awake and at home, there will be no diapers. And there haven't been. Though we have been through 8 pairs of underwear. The floor was peed on 6 times, the potty peed in once. The seventh dirty diaper was a poopy bum. Though she did tell me while she was pooping that she was, I just didn't get her to the potty in time. I am trying to tell myself to stay the course, it will only get easier.

I have decided that I need two more tools to continue to potty train. I need to get a potty that she can get on herself, I saw some second hand Baby Bjorn ones that I am going to invest in, and we need some more underwear. I think I will take her with me to pick out the big girl panties, she can choose what she wants and maybe it will provide some motivation for her!
